DownloadManager 下载Apk 打开时 解析应用包是出错

这个问题是没有把下载地址放在SDCard中导致的,如果下载没有指定下载路径将会下到你的应用的cache中,其他应用是没有权限来打开这个文件的,所以你要指定到SDCard中,这样才可以使用安装器来安装

一下代码是指定下载地址的

request.setDestinationInExternalFilesDir(getActivity(),
                Environment.getExternalStoragePublicDirectory(Environment.DIRECTORY_DOWNLOADS).getAbsolutePath(),
                appType.name+”.apk”);

之后我会出个详细的博文来显示如何调用DownloadManager下载和打开APK文件

    原文作者:@47
    原文地址: https://www.cnblogs.com/Jabba93/p/3432523.html
    本文转自网络文章,转载此文章仅为分享知识,如有侵权,请联系博主进行删除。
点赞